In this paper bis-arylselene alkenes were synthesized using KF/Al2O3 as a base and PEG-400 as a solvent (Scheme 1). The methodology proposed is based on the principles of Green Chemistry, in which by a one-pot procedure from terminal alkynes (1) and diaryl diselenides (2), the corresponding bisselene alkenes of configuration Z (3) were obtained in good yields for eight examples, with aromatic and aliphatic substituents.
